SERC Disaster Search and Rescue (DSR) Committee
|
|
CHARTER |
Under the authority of Section 1, Article VIII, State Emergency Response Commission (SERC) Bylaws, I hereby establish the Disaster Search and Rescue (DSR) Committee, as an ad hoc committee of the SERC, to enhance USAR capabilities within Alaska.
|
|
DUTIES |
The Committee shall meet at the direction of its chairperson to accomplish the following objectives: (1) identify existing DSR capabilities and deficiencies within the State, (2) take short-term steps using existing resources to increase DSR preparedness in Alaska, and (3) make recommendations to the SERC for long-term steps, which may require additional resources, that would further enhance the States DSR capabilities.
|
|
OFFICERS |
The representative from the State Division of Homeland Security and Emergency Management will serve as the Committee chairperson and will arrange for necessary staff support. Each department or agency must provide funding support from its operating budget for its Committee representative.
|
|
WORK PLAN |
The Committee provided its first report to the SERC at the SERCs January 7, 1998, meeting. Subsequent status reports are made to the SERC at the SERCs quarterly meetings.
|
|
COMMITTEE COMPOSITION |
At a minimum, the Disaster Search and Rescue (DSR) Committee shall consist of representatives from the Anchorage Fire Department, the Municipality of Anchorage, the State Division of Homeland Security and Emergency Management (DHS&EM), the State Division of Natural Resources (DNR), the AK State Fire Chiefs Association, the Alaska National Guard, the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, the U.S. Department of Defense, the U.S. Department of the Interior, the U.S. Coast Guard – District 17 and the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A).
